Best Places to Study in Dallas:

Now, let’s dive into the best places to hit the books in Dallas:

1. Dallas Public Library

The Dallas Public Library is a haven for bookworms and students alike. With its quiet ambiance, vast collection of resources, and free Wi-Fi access, it’s the perfect place to focus and get work done.

2. Coffee House

If you prefer a cozy atmosphere with a touch of caffeine, Dallas is known for its thriving coffee culture. Head to a local coffee house like The Brew Spot or Brewed for a blend of delicious beverages and a study-friendly environment.

3. University Libraries

Most universities in Dallas have well-equipped libraries that offer an extensive range of study materials and resources. Whether you’re a student or not, some university libraries allow public access, providing a great study spot with all the necessary facilities.

4. Co-working Spaces

If you thrive in collaborative environments, consider exploring the various co-working spaces in Dallas. These spaces offer a mix of private and communal work areas, allowing you to network with like-minded individuals while staying productive.
